Economic independence has completely transformed women's decision-making power. Today, Indian women are: Buying their own homes and investing in financial markets.

No story is complete without shadows. The pressure to bear sons, the expectation to cook despite a fever, the catcalls on a work commute, the debates over a girl’s curfew—these are real. Menstruation, though slowly destigmatized, still forces many girls to miss school due to lack of toilets or taboo. Domestic violence is a hidden epidemic that cuts across class. Yet, resistance is growing. Daughters are fighting for education, grandmothers are learning to sign their names, and women are reporting harassment via online portals.

Modern fashion in India heavily features fusion wear. It is common to see women pairing ethnic block-print skirts with Western crop tops, or sporting traditional silver jewelry with formal corporate suits.

Interestingly, there is a massive "return to roots" movement. Ancient superfoods like millets, turmeric, and moringa—staples in grandmothers' kitchens for centuries—are being rebranded as modern wellness essentials. Yoga, once a spiritual practice, is now a daily fitness pillar for the urban Indian woman seeking balance in a chaotic world. The (six yards of elegance) remains the gold standard, but its draping styles vary by region—from the Bengali pallu to the Maharashtrian kashta . However, the Kurta set and Salwar Kameez are the daily workhorses for comfort. The biggest shift is the rise of Fusion wear . Young Indian professionals pair sarees with crop tops and blazers. The Sindoor (vermilion) and Mangalsutra (sacred necklace), once mandatory marital symbols, are now optional accessories for modern brides. Simultaneously, sneakers are replacing juttis as the footwear of choice for women running corporate and domestic errands.
